Integration With Azure DevOps and Team Foundation Server - Requirements

Applies to TestComplete 14.20, last modified on September 11, 2019

Team Server

You can run TestComplete tests if you use one of the following:

  • Azure DevOps Services (formerly known as Visual Studio Team Services or VSTS).

    Note: Use self-hosted (private) agents to run TestComplete tests. Running TestComplete tests on Microsoft-hosted agents is not supported.
  • Azure DevOps Server 2019

  • Team Foundation Server 2015–2018

Test Agents

Your test agents (remote computers where your TestComplete tests will be run) must have the following software installed:

  • TestComplete 14 (or TestExecute 14)

  • Visual Studio

    – or –

    Visual Studio Test Platform

    Note: You can configure your pipeline to install Visual Studio Test Platform automatically during the run.

The test agent must be running as an interactive process so that TestComplete (TestExecute) can interact with the desktop and with the tested application's UI.
